In order for your marigolds to be ready for planting outdoors in the spring, you will need to start growing marigolds from seed … WebApr 9, 2024 · When starting marigold seeds indoors, it is important to have the right supplies. Start by collecting a few essentials. You’ll need a seed-starting tray, a seed-starting soil mix, a watering can, and a spray bottle. For best results, use a sterile seed-starting soil mix that contains a combination of peat moss, perlite, and vermiculite.

WebFeb 15, 2024 · Set the seed starting trays on a dish and add a thin layer of water to the bottom of the dish multiple times for 10 to 30 minutes. Use your finger to touch the top of the soil to ensure that moisture has reached the top of the container, then move the seed trays out of the water-filled dish and back under the light.
